Total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) in Post-demographic dividend
Post-demographic dividend: Total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) was 9.25 in 2020. ▼ Falling
Total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) in Post-demographic dividend, 2000–2020
Source: Global Health Observatory Data Repository, World Health Organization (WHO).
Analysis
The most recent figure for total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) in Post-demographic dividend is 9.25, measured in 2020. That is the lowest value across all 21 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 2.4% on the previous year and down 4.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) in Post-demographic dividend peaked at 10.33 in 2000 and was at its lowest, 9.25, in 2020.
That places Post-demographic dividend 5th out of 47 groups with data for 2020, putting it in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 21 years of available data.
Total alcohol consumption per capita (liters of pure alcohol) in Post-demographic dividend,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 10.33 | — |
| 2001 | 10.33 | -0.0% |
| 2002 | 10.24 | -0.9% |
| 2003 | 10.15 | -0.9% |
| 2004 | 10.11 | -0.3% |
| 2005 | 10.09 | -0.2% |
| 2006 | 10.07 | -0.2% |
| 2007 | 10.04 | -0.3% |
| 2008 | 9.95 | -0.9% |
| 2009 | 9.82 | -1.3% |
| 2010 | 9.72 | -0.9% |
| 2011 | 9.69 | -0.4% |
| 2012 | 9.68 | -0.1% |
| 2013 | 9.61 | -0.7% |
| 2014 | 9.53 | -0.8% |
| 2015 | 9.49 | -0.4% |
| 2016 | 9.48 | -0.1% |
| 2017 | 9.48 | -0.0% |
| 2018 | 9.48 | -0.0% |
| 2019 | 9.48 | +0.0% |
| 2020 | 9.25 | -2.4% |

About this data
Total alcohol per capita consumption is defined as the total (sum of recorded and unrecorded alcohol) amount of alcohol consumed per person (15 years of age or older) over a calendar year, in litres of pure alcohol, adjusted for tourist consumption.
